    Don't use the old syntax 'SID=...' in tnsnames.ora, use 'SERVICE_NAME=...' . Make sure 'SERVICE_NAME' is exactly the same returned by 'lsnrctl status' on both nodes.
    Primary and standby cannot talk to each other currently through the listener:
    ORA-16664: unable to receive the result from a database
    Cause: During execution of a command, a database in the Data Guard broker
    configuration failed to return a result.
    Action: Check Data Guard broker logs for the details of the failure. Fix any
    possible network problems and try the command again.
    ORA-12514: TNS:listener does not currently know of service requested in connect descriptor
    Cause: The listener received a request to establish a connection to a database or other service. The connect descriptor received by the listener specified a service name for a service (usually a database service) that either has not yet dynamically registered with the listener or has not been statically configured for the listener. This may be a temporary condition such as after the listener has started, but before the database instance has registered with the listener.
    Action: - Wait a moment and try to connect a second time.
    - Check which services are currently known by the listener by executing: lsnrctl services <listener name>
    - Check that the SERVICE_NAME parameter in the connect descriptor of the net service name used specifies a service known by the listener.
    - If an easy connect naming connect identifier was used, check that the service name specified is a service known by the listener.
    - Check for an event in the listener.log file.

  • What can I do about "LabVIEW load error code 38: Failed to uncompress part of the VI."

    While attempting to load an executable LabVIEW application for LabVIEW 2009 SP1 on a Windows-XP machine when the following pop-up message occurs. "LabVIEW: Memory or data structure corrupt. An error occurs in loading VI 'NI_Gmath.lblib: Backward Bracket Search.VI'. LabVIEW load error code 38: Failed to uncompress part of the VI. The VI is most likely corrupt." What seems odd is that the same LabVIEW application loads fine when logged on as a privileged user account, but fails to load on a private user account.
    Attachments:
    2012-07-18 LabVIEW Load error code 38.jpg ‏1314 KB

    Here's a thought:
    So when something is decompressed, a temp folder is often used. 
    I have no idea why LabVIEW would be decompressing anything, but I suspect it is trying to put the decompressed file into a temp folder where the user does not have write permissions.
    In the .ini file for your executable, you can add a line that specified the location of the temp folder to use:
    tmpdir=C:\Temp
    On my Win7 machine, the location is:
    C:\Users\MyUserName\AppData\Local\Temp
    On WinXP, it is probably:
    C:\Documents And Settings\YourUserName\local settings\temp
     Try changing the tmpdir key in your ini file to something to C:\Temp and see if that helps.

    I'm using WL9.2 and my migratable server is actually up and running (is that what you mean about booted?).                    I meant checking your log files to make sure that the JMS server itself actually booted, not checking that the host WL server was up. (For example you should see INFO messages indicating that the JMS server has loaded "X" records from its persistent store).
              >>> Could you elaborate on the known problem?
              9.x MDBs have special code for enhanced handling of remote distributed destinations. I'm guessing that this code is somehow causing problems when the remote JMS server is migratable. I don't have enough information to elaborate further than that.
              >>> What else I can try?
              Beyond contacting customer support, I'm not sure.
